Born in 1977, Katia Rahi is an interior architect and graduate of the Institute of Fine Arts in Furn El Chebbak. With extensive experience in the fields of architecture and design, she established her own studio in 2010, developing an approach that harmonizes functionality, aesthetics, and emotion. Alongside her architectural career, she has always nurtured a profound passion for abstract painting — a personal and expressive language where each brushstroke reveals an emotion, a memory, or an inner reflection. Through her work, she explores the relationship between material, color, and movement, creating a universe filled with sensitivity and depth. A mother of two daughters, Katia Rahi continues to pursue her artistic journey with the same discipline and sensitivity that define her professional path. Her exhibition “Rebirth Beirut” marks a significant milestone in her career, unveiling an inner world rich in emotion, texture, and silent narratives.
